Self Build Log Cabins: Before You Self Build

Self Build

Self build log cabins have captured the attention of millions of individuals around the world because of their great advantages and benefits. If you are one of those people who have always dreamed of owning a log cabin, then self build log cabins should be the ideal choice. However, you need to be very meticulous with your plans to avoid major problems with the construction. A lot of individuals just rush into self building without really placing a lot of thought in their decision. This may actually lead into potential problems due to the lack of planning and personal preparation. With self build log cabins, you need to be prepared to take on the challenges of construction because you may eventually suffer from setbacks in your project. For instance, a supplier may run out of materials that you have previously ordered a few weeks back. The lack of materials will only delay your project, and might even cost you more because of the extension of your construction schedule. You may also encounter a few issues with your contractors, which is actually a common occurrence. Therefore, you need to be prepared physically, mentally and emotionally before you embark on the world of self building.

 

One of the major aspects that you need to prepare on are the practical skills involved in self building. You really do not need to have a lot of skills and talents when it comes to construction because you can always hire the services of professional contractors to handle these for you. However, if you truly want your project to be successful, you need to be armed with practical skills to help you overcome those challenges and trials that may come along the way. To handle the job well, you need to be highly organized with your plans and preparations. The best site managers always have a complete list of everything that needs to be done within a specific timeframe. You need to come up with a checklist or a schedule that contains all of the pertinent aspects within the different levels of your construction. You should also organize all of the documents, paperwork, designs and blueprints for safekeeping. Receipts and vouchers should also be organized to keep track of all the expenses.

 

You should also be prepared to do a lot of negotiating during the self build project. To get the best prices and rates in the market, you need to negotiate the different prices in order to come up with the best value. You should also learn how to properly coordinate with different suppliers in order to have a smooth working relationship for your project. In addition, you should also be prepared to deal directly with different kinds of people because you will actually be in full control over the contractors and individuals who may be involved in your project. There is no room for shyness or aloofness in self building because you need to be able to deal with all sorts of personalities to get the job done.

 

If you feel that you are mentally and emotionally prepared to handle self building, you can proceed to the basic details of your log cabin plans and financing.

It’s quite common these days for consumers to buy their dining room chairs as separate items to the dining table itself and there are many reasons why this may be your best option. If you’re currently in the market for a new set of chairs then there are many aspects to consider before making a purchase.

Maybe you want to contrast the chairs from the table itself and if this is the case, you need to be sure that there isn’t too much of a clash. Individual tastes are unique to each buyer but consider all of your options very carefully before you make an expensive mistake.

If you’re picking up dining chairs to match your existing table then once again, consider the match of styles and colours carefully. If both are in the same natural wood then there may still be a difference in the shading but an option could be to varnish or even paint the table and chairs separately in order to get that perfect match.

Size is something that shouldn’t be taken for granted so don’t just assume that your new chairs will slot under your dining table perfectly. Make all the necessary measurements before buying so that you don’t have to send those chairs back for a refund.

As far as the quantity is concerned, think about the maximum number of diners that your table can accommodate but don’t necessarily purchase the same number of chairs. If you regularly host eight diners then acquiring eight chairs is an obvious path to follow but if that happens on the rarest of occasions then you should consider scaling down.

Large numbers of dining chairs will clutter a room and it also means you have more items of furniture to clean, dust and maintain. For this example, four chairs could be more than adequate and remember that you can always store additional fold away chairs in cases of emergency.

Moving on to the style of furniture, the choice is entirely yours once again but you’ll need to consider the contrasting benefits that different chairs offer.

High back dining room chairs are popular because they encourage good posture and discourage you from hunching over the table – a habit that can actually lead to back problems over a period of time. Soft back chairs are a good option if you spend a lot of time at the table because they concentrate more on your comfort levels. You’ll also experience greater comfort from extra deep chairs.

If you’re a traditionalist, you may want to opt for hard wood chairs but if comfort is an issue, simply invest in some good quality cushions.

When you’re arranging car hire of any kind it makes sense to be armed with all the facts before you sign on the dotted line. While we all like to think that we spend ample time studying the small print of any agreement, the truth is we may have little time to take it in fully.

When it comes to car hire there are a number of unusual elements to the contract that could see you paying unnecessary charges once the vehicle is returned and here is a brief guide as to how to avoid them.

Most hire companies will give you a full tank of petrol and then ask that you return it in the same condition as it left the forecourt. If you neglect to do this, then you could pay a higher price for the fuel that the hirer uses to fill up and in addition, you may be asked to pay a ‘fuelling charge’ on top.

In rare cases, some car hire firms may ask you to provide a receipt for your fuel purchases so remember to obtain one to prevent any problems from occurring. On occasions, drivers will rent a vehicle for a small local trip and hope that the fuel gauge hasn’t moved enough to be noticeable to the hire firm. This is why the measure has been introduced and while it’s still quite rare, it makes sense to get a fuel receipt when you top up.

Car hire companies will look for reimbursement with regards to the slightest of damage. Even if you scuff the tyres when you’re driving the car, you will be asked to repay any costs so remember that you are liable for problems of this kind.

Late return fees can also be a contentious issue under any car hire contract so make sure you fully understand the requirements of the individual hirer as to the exact time they need the vehicle back. Often there is a very small period of grace and it could be less than half an hour so always aim to return on time. If you are late because of traffic or other circumstances beyond your control, try to pull over and phone ahead to alert the company of any problems.

Early return fees can also apply in some cases so be fully aware of timings before you sign the contract.

One of the more obvious stipulations to look for concerns mileage limitations and these will generally come into play if you hire the vehicle for a longer period of time, such as a month or maybe more.

If you are likely to stray over the limit, additional charges can be punitive so try to get as high a mileage limit as possible under your car hire agreement.

The majority of car hire contracts are very transparent and there should be no nasty surprises waiting for the driver when the vehicle is returned. However, it is advisable to be aware of any potential charges before you agree to any contract of this kind.
